Position Description:

What You Will Do

Prepare advanced level of multiple accounting and financial activities to ensure compliance with rules, regulations, and legislation; analyze their effect on company finances and accounting procedures (as specified by position).

Analyze journal entries, records, account reconciliations, and reports. Analyze studies and recommendations in areas related to accounting or finance methods and procedures.

Develop applicable programs used in finance and other accounting activities. Perform calculations and analyses including:

  • Actual to forecast and historical period variance analysis
  • Share-based accounting
  • EPS
  • Depreciations (book)
  • Financial ratios
  • Rate/tariff schedules
  • Derivative entries and disclosures
  • Allocations
  • Projections/forecasts
  • Cash flow

Assist employees compiling, verifying, and preparing a variety of financial information including:

  • Actual to forecast and historical period variance analysis
  • Governmental/regulatory reports
  • Invoices
  • Financial reports
  • Reconciliation reports
  • Quarterly income statements
  • Billing Revenues
  • Gas supply tracking and reconciliations
  • Cost of gas calculations
  • Budget

Help with the development, maintenance and usage of relevant applications for accounting and financial analysis activities.
